2003 Ferrari 612 vs. 1981 Audi 4000
To start off, 2003 Ferrari 612 is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Audi 4000.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Audi 4000 would be higher. At 5,746 cc (12 cylinders), 2003 Ferrari 612 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Ferrari 612 (541 HP @ 7250 RPM) has 441 more horse power than 1981 Audi 4000. (100 HP @ 4250 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Ferrari 612 should accelerate faster than 1981 Audi 4000.
Because 1981 Audi 4000 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2003 Ferrari 612.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1981 Audi 4000 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Ferrari 612 (588 Nm) has 451 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Audi 4000. (137 Nm). This means 2003 Ferrari 612 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Audi 4000.
